On 13 May 2022, AL EMARAT, the second GOWIND corvette ordered by the United Arab Emirates (UAE) from Naval Group, was launched in Lorient, France in the presence of an official delegation from the UAE Navy. In 2019, the UAE ordered two GOWIND class corvettes to be built in France. The first unit, BANI YAS, was launched in December 2021.
Naval Group will also train the UAE Navy’s crew from the equipment level up to the operational level. Starting in France, this preparation will continue with teambuilding and practice on operational scenarios in every warfare area in the Gulf.
Thus far, 12 units of the GOWIND design have been sold. Most of them are built locally through transfer of technology and partnerships with local industry. An example is in Egypt, where three units are now in service within the Egyptian Navy.
